Transaction ffddeaed1d300ef5fbcbbd39bf8dc00ae536c5a7476832cd69fa0dc1913321fe
1 Input
1 Output
-
ffddeaed1d300ef5fbcbbd39bf8dc00ae536c5a7476832cd69fa0dc1913321fe:0
- value
- 266383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83be634b3fad738cde20b2b91268cff48dced1a8 OP_EQUAL
- address
- 3DhcX47QK7wBLA2UhwGYqtNdsj6g3LtWy9